It is a circuitry device that transfers power from source to load in an efficient, compact, and robust manner for ensuring convenient utilization. It is usually used to control the adaptation of electric power from one form to another using transistors, diodes, and thrusters. Operations at high current or high voltage can be proficiently executed by utilizing power electronics devices, as they reveal faster switching rate at higher efficiency. Furthermore, it controls unidirectional as well as bidirectional flow of energy. Power electronics devices are likely to serve as the future key technologies that help to enhance the system efficiency and performance in automotive & energy saving applications. It enables the power management in order to increase energy conservation in various applications such as electric automobiles, consumer electronics, automotive, and industrial systems. Based on device type, power electronics market can be segregated as power module, power discrete, power IC and others. Power module is further sub-segmented as standard & power integrated module (IGBT module and MOSFET module), intelligent power module and others. Power discrete segment is further sub-segmented as transistors (FET, BJT and IGBT), diode and thyristor. Based on material type, market can be segregated as silicon carbide, silicon and gallium nitride. In addition, based on application, market can be segregated as consumer electronics, automotive & transportation, industrial (energy & power), ICT, aerospace & defense, and others. The power electronics market is driven by surge in adoption of power electronics in the manufacturing of electric vehicles, followed by growth in focus on the use of renewable power sources, rise in need for power management devices and increase in demand from consumer electronics. However, complex design & integration process may impact the market. Moreover, growth in industrialization in developing economies and increase in use of Gallium nitride (GaN) & silicon carbide (SiC) products in various applications are leading opportunities for market. Furthermore, ever-changing demand for more compact & efficient devices at low prices is a major challenge for global market. Based on geography, the Asia-Pacific is the leading region in global power electronics market owing to rise in opportunities in automotive, ICT, consumer electronics, and industrial applications across the region. The North-America and Europe regions are estimated to exhibit higher CAGR due to rise in demand for industrial and energy & power verticals for power electronic devices over the forecast period.
